Development Trends in PU Foam Machinery

In recent years, the PU foam machinery market has witnessed significant advancements. Manufacturers are increasingly focusing on automation and digital integration to improve production efficiencies and product quality. The rise of Industry 4.0 technologies plays a pivotal role in this development. This trend involves smarter and more connected machinery systems capable of self-optimizing performance and predictive maintenance.

For instance, a well-known manufacturer integrated IoT sensors into their PU foam machinery, allowing real-time data collection and analysis. This innovation not only reduces downtime through predictive maintenance but also enhances product quality by adjusting operational parameters on-the-fly based on feedback.

Technological Trends: From Traditional Methods to Advanced Solutions

Technology is reshaping the landscape of PU foam machinery through enhancements such as energy-efficient systems and environmentally friendly solutions. Where traditional methods relied heavily on manual operations, today's machinery embraces automation to minimize human intervention, thereby reducing the margin for error.

Moreover, technological advancements have led to the development of eco-friendly PU foams, reducing the environmental footprint of production processes. The advent of alternative blowing agents, which replace ozone-depleting chemicals, represents a significant leap toward sustainability.

Application Prospects: Expanding Horizons

The future of PU foam machinery is promising, with expanding application prospects across diverse industries. In the automotive sector, for example, PU foams are crucial for sound insulation and comfort enhancement in vehicles. This demand is poised to increase as electric vehicles proliferate, necessitating lightweight and efficient solutions.

In construction, PU foams serve as excellent insulators, crucial for energy-efficient building designs. The push towards greener buildings directly influences the demand for PU foam machinery, driving the need for advanced machines capable of producing high-quality foam suitable for rigorous applications.

Future Development Direction and Market Demand

Market demand for PU foam machinery is set to grow, driven by the increasing call for high-performance materials in various sectors. To meet this demand, manufacturers are focusing on enhancing machine versatility and adaptability. This includes easing the switch between different foam densities and formulations to cater to diverse industry requirements.

Additionally, the market is witnessing a shift towards more compact and energy-efficient machinery. This is particularly relevant in emerging economies where on-site space and energy costs are critical considerations. Manufacturers aiming to capture these markets must innovate to deliver compact and efficient solutions that maintain performance and reliability.

Innovations Through Multidisciplinary Cooperation

Innovation in PU foam machinery is increasingly occurring at the intersection of disciplines. Cross-industry collaborations have been instrumental in driving advancements. For example, partnerships between chemical engineers and AI experts have led to the development of smart formulations and adaptive production controls.

An illustrative story involves a partnership between a PU foam machinery maker and a tech startup specializing in machine learning. By integrating advanced algorithms, they developed a machine capable of automatically adjusting to material inconsistencies, resulting in consistently high-quality outputs.

These multidisciplinary collaborations are pivotal for overcoming the complex challenges associated with PU foam process manufacturing, paving the way for groundbreaking innovations that cater to current and future market needs.
